What Is Slot Volatility?
Volatility, also known as variance, refers to the risk level associated with a particular slot game. It measures how frequently and how much a slot pays out over time. Different slots have different volatility levels, and each offers a unique playing experience.
Low vs. High Volatility Slots
Low volatility slots provide frequent, smaller wins. These games are perfect if you prefer steady gameplay without large swings in your bankroll. You’ll experience longer gaming sessions with consistent payouts.
High volatility slots offer larger jackpots but win less frequently. These games appeal to players who enjoy the thrill of chasing big prizes and can handle longer dry spells between wins.
Why This Matters
Understanding volatility helps you choose games that match your playing style and bankroll management strategy. If you have limited funds, low volatility games keep you entertained longer. If you’re chasing substantial wins, high volatility slots might be more appealing.
